Slovenia's Green Shift: The Growing Demand for Sustainable Living Solutions

As the world increasingly prioritizes environmental sustainability, Slovenia is emerging as a beacon of eco-friendly living. This shift is not merely a trend but a fundamental change in consumer behavior, driven by a collective awareness of climate change and its impacts. The demand for sustainable living solutions is reshaping the real estate landscape, with buyers and investors actively seeking properties that adhere to green standards. From energy-efficient homes equipped with solar panels to buildings constructed from sustainable materials, the emphasis on eco-conscious design is palpable.

Local developers are responding to this demand by incorporating innovative technologies and sustainable practices into their projects. Initiatives such as green roofs, rainwater harvesting systems, and energy-efficient appliances are becoming standard features in new developments. This transformation not only enhances the quality of life for residents but also contributes to Slovenia's commitment to reducing its carbon footprint. As the green shift gains momentum, it is clear that sustainable living solutions will play a pivotal role in shaping the future of Slovenia's real estate market.

Innovations and Strategies Driving Eco-Friendly Real Estate

Innovations and strategies are at the forefront of the eco-friendly real estate movement in Slovenia, shaping a sustainable future for the market. One notable innovation is the integration of smart home technologies that optimize energy consumption. These systems not only enhance comfort but also significantly reduce utility costs, appealing to environmentally conscious buyers. Additionally, the use of sustainable building materials, such as recycled steel and reclaimed wood, is becoming increasingly popular. These materials not only minimize environmental impact but also offer unique aesthetic qualities that attract modern homeowners.

Moreover, developers are adopting green roofs and vertical gardens, which not only improve air quality but also contribute to urban biodiversity. Strategies such as community engagement in eco-friendly initiatives further bolster the appeal of these properties, fostering a sense of belonging among residents. As Slovenia continues to embrace these innovations, the eco-friendly real estate sector is poised for substantial growth, aligning with global sustainability goals while meeting the evolving demands of consumers.

The Future Outlook: Economic and Environmental Benefits of Green Properties

As Slovenia's real estate market continues to embrace eco-friendly properties, the future outlook presents a promising landscape marked by significant economic and environmental benefits. Green properties not only contribute to reduced carbon footprints but also enhance energy efficiency, leading to lower utility costs for homeowners. This financial advantage is particularly appealing in a time of rising energy prices, making sustainable living not just an ethical choice but a practical one.

Moreover, the shift towards eco-friendly developments is expected to stimulate local economies, creating jobs in green construction and renewable energy sectors. As more developers invest in sustainable practices, Slovenia can position itself as a leader in the green real estate movement, attracting both domestic and international buyers who prioritize sustainability.

In addition to economic gains, the environmental benefits are profound. By reducing waste and promoting biodiversity, green properties contribute to healthier ecosystems. As awareness grows, the demand for such properties is likely to rise, fostering a culture of sustainability that aligns with Slovenia's commitment to environmental stewardship.
